94 results about "Pregnenolone" patented technology

Pregnenolone (P5), or pregn-5-en-3β-ol-20-one, is an endogenous steroid and precursor/metabolic intermediate in the biosynthesis of most of the steroid hormones, including the progestogens, androgens, estrogens, glucocorticoids, and mineralocorticoids. In addition, pregnenolone is biologically active in its own right, acting as a neurosteroid.

Method for synthesizing cholesterol by using pregnenolone as raw material

The invention provides a method for synthesizing cholesterol by using pregnenolone as a raw material. The method comprises the following steps: 1) adding potassium acetate into methyl alcohol, and performing a reaction on sulfonate to obtain 6-methoxyl-3,5-cyclo-5alpha-pregn-20-one; 2) performing a reaction on triphenylphosphine and 1-chloro-4-methylpentane in an aprotic solvent to obtain a 4-methylbutyltriphenyl phosphonium chloride solution; 3) adding potassium tert-butoxide into the 4-methylbutyltriphenyl phosphonium chloride solution, and performing a wittig reaction; 4) under the catalysis of a rhodium catalyst, performing an asymmetric hydrogenation reaction to obtain 6-methoxyl-3,5-cyclo-5alpha-cholestane; 5) performing a catalytic hydrolysis deprotection reaction by using sulfuric acid to obtain the cholesterol. The method provided by the invention has the advantages that six-step reactions in the conventional method are simplified into four-step reactions, and a ring-opening reaction in which a great number of hydrochloric acid and a large number of zinc powder are consumed in a route of using saponin as an initial raw material. The synthesizing method is simple in process, the consumption of the raw material and auxiliary materials is low, and the mole yield is high; the method is economical and environmentally friendly, and facilitates industrial implementation.

Method for recovering progesterone from progesterone production mother liquor

The invention relates to a method for recovering progesterone from a progesterone production mother liquor. The progesterone production mother liquor can be a crude product mother liquor generated in a process for producing progesterone by oxidizing pregnenolone and a refined mother liquor. The method comprises the following steps: steaming out a solvent in the mother liquor, dissolving mother liquor residues obtained after distillation in a new solvent, washing with a dilute acid, washing with water to neutrality, carrying out refluxing water diversion, detecting the weight of each of main components comprising progesterone and pregnenolone after the water diversion, oxidizing pregnenolone by cyclohexanone and aluminum isopropoxide, adding an acid to neutralize, washing with water, steaming out the new solvent, adding a crystallization solvent for crystallizing to obtain crude progesterone, and refining the crude progesterone to obtain progesterone. The method changing the progesterone mother liquor to valuables has the following advantages: progesterone in the mother liquor is recovered, so the total yield of progesterone is improved by about 4.0%, thereby the economic benefit of progesterone is improved; and the emission of dangerous wastes (containing hormone compounds) is reduced, so the pollution to the environment is reduced.
